I have a Seagate 160gb Momentus 7200.4 drive that I believe the serial flash memory has gotten corrupt somehow.
Drive: Seagate ST9160412AS - FW: 0002CE21 PCB: 100536286 Rev E
Symptoms and what i've done so far:
Drive will not spin up but is detected by a pc and identified correctly.
I located a PCB, is a close match but from a 320gb hdd. Installed it to the 160gb drive and applied power to see if spindle spins. Yes spindle spins.
I swapped the serial flash from the 160gb PCB to the 320gb PCB and installed it. Drive does not spin with 160gb serial flash chip installed.
I put the 320gb serial flash back on the 320gb board and drive spins again but I did not leave it powered on due to being from a wrong size drive.
I attached 160gb serial flash chip to a programmer and was able to get good clean identical reads 3 times in a row with no bad reads at all, so it indicates the flash chip itself is ok.
It seems like the FW on the serial flash may be corrupt.
If i got a flash file from the same model drive with the same firmware is it possible to write a new flash chip and recover the data or am i out of luck because the flash would contain all the calibrations and error table, etc, for this drive to recover?

The IAP segment contains an Identify Device data block.
The ATA standard states that bit #5 of word #86 is the PUIS enabled flag.
Bit #5 of word #83 is the PUIS supported flag.
Word #83 = 0x7F69
Word #86 = 0x0060
Therefore PUIS is supported and enabled. A tool such as HDAT2 can enable/disable PUIS.

Thank you, that put me in the right track, I used HDAT2 and got the drive spinning and disabled PUIS.
The drive is in pretty sad shape, it shows all partitions and your able to read some blocks, then errors out till the next reset then, rinse and repeat.
I'm slowly getting some from it so i'll have to say this was a success.
